WebMar 30, 2024 · When you’re signing the NDA, make sure you are signing as the right party. Long story short, if you’re signing on a company’s behalf, you’ll have the company listed as the signatory, your name under the signature line, and “By: “ to the left of the signature line. Forming an LLC provides a built-in legal business structure and liability protection for the business owner. Because an LLC is an entirely separate entity from the owner, any lawsuit brought against the LLC cannot affect the owner’s personal assets. Small business owners who want liability ...

WebMar 30, 2024 · A disregarded entity is a business that is separate from its owner but which elects to be disregarded as separate from the business owner for federal tax purposes. 1 . If this sounds like a double negative, it is. Another way to say this is that the business is not separated from the owner for tax purposes. The business pays tax as part of ...
